    A couple of weeks ago a small toy store here in town ("here" meaning in Germany) went out of business, because their lease wasn't renewed at a bearable rate. When they had their final sales I went to pick up some Lego, part for investment, part for my collection, I stumbled across a bunch of display cases with price tags on them. Last year I had asked the boss at their head store (they belonged to a very small chain) what happened to these cases if they were replaced and he told me they (the cases) were going back to Lego and they (the store) were not allowed to sell them.     These 6 LEGO displays from the San Diego Comic Con several years ago were very limited in supply. Each display was 1 of 300 and there were 6 different displays, each with different minifigures and backrounds. This seller has all 6 for sale at once...A COMPLETE SET!!! Nice find...
